Instructions

1

Fry the Plantains

Fry plantain chunks in olive oil over medium heat for about 8 minutes turning occasionally until golden and cooked through.

2

Mash with Garlic

Transfer fried plantains to a large bowl or pilon and mash with minced garlic, a drizzle of olive oil, and salt until a slightly chunky paste forms.

3

Shape the Mofongo

Press mashed plantains into a bowl or cup, then invert onto a plate to create a round mound shape.

4

Top and Serve

Warm shredded chicken in chicken broth for 3 minutes then spoon over the mofongo mound and serve immediately.

Substitutions

green plantainsyuca root for a slightly different but equally kid friendly starch
shredded chickenground beef cooked with sofrito for a heartier version

Common mistakes

Using ripe plantains creates a sweet mofongo that does not match the savory broth topping
Not mashing plantains thoroughly enough results in a lumpy texture kids may refuse to eat
